It seems that a common buzz word these days is "Apps". Whether you are viewing the menu at UNO's Chicago Grill or the one on an iPhone there seems to be an "App" for everything. As part of the ongoing discussions in this blog "Apps" promote another key way to distribute content. iPhone Apps are being utilized in the print media industry in applications where the iPhone can be used as a medium to review customer print orders from inception to production.

One of the lectures in my Media Distribution & Transmission class this week was focused on media distribution workflow. There are many traditional workflow structures, but with so many multi-channel offerings we continually move away from the old ways of distributing content. The options are seemingly endless and the pace of technology will allow this trend to continue.
